Customer Reviews Back to Business Profile
-
christine S.
-
Christie M.
-
Veronica Y.
-
Bervolynn E.
-
Becky V.
-
Joy S.
-
Nancy R.
-
Kiran K.
-
Laurel C.
-
Cayla C.
Neos Medspa
Medical Spa
1730 E Warner Rd #3
Tempe, AZ 85284
United States
Tue - Sat: 10:00am - 5:00pm
+1 (480) 725-6252